| // S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0+
 | |
| /*
 | |
|  * Power Domain test commands
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Copyright (C) 2020 Texas Instruments Incorporated, <www.ti.com>
 | |
|  */
 | |
| 
 | |
| #include <command.h>
 | |
| #include <dm.h>
 | |
| #include <k3-dev.h>
 | |
| 
 | |
| static const struct udevice_id ti_pd_of_match[] = {
 | |
| 	{ .compatible = "ti,sci-pm-domain" },
 | |
| 	{ /* sentinel */ }
 | |
| };
 | |
| 
 | |
| static struct ti_k3_pd_platdata *ti_pd_find_data(void)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	struct udevice *dev;
 | |
| 	int i = 0;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	while (1) {
 | |
| 		uclass_get_device(UCLASS_POWER_DOMAIN, i++, &dev);
 | |
| 		if (!dev)
 | |
| 			return NULL;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 		if (device_is_compatible(dev,
 | |
| 					 ti_pd_of_match[0].compatible))
 | |
| 			return  dev_get_priv(dev);
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	return NULL;
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| static void dump_lpsc(struct ti_k3_pd_platdata *data, struct ti_pd *pd)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	int i;
 | |
| 	struct ti_lpsc *lpsc;
 | |
| 	u8 state;
 | |
| 	static const char * const lpsc_states[] = {
 | |
| 		"swrstdis", "syncrst", "disable", "enable", "autosleep",
 | |
| 		"autowake", "unknown",
 | |
| 	};
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	for (i = 0; i < data->num_lpsc; i++) {
 | |
| 		lpsc = &data->lpsc[i];
 | |
| 		if (lpsc->pd != pd)
 | |
| 			continue;
 | |
| 		state = lpsc_get_state(lpsc);
 | |
| 		if (state > ARRAY_SIZE(lpsc_states))
 | |
| 			state = ARRAY_SIZE(lpsc_states) - 1;
 | |
| 		printf("    LPSC%d: state=%s, usecount=%d\n",
 | |
| 		       lpsc->id, lpsc_states[state], lpsc->usecount);
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| static void dump_pd(struct ti_k3_pd_platdata *data, struct ti_psc *psc)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	int i;
 | |
| 	struct ti_pd *pd;
 | |
| 	u8 state;
 | |
| 	static const char * const pd_states[] = {
 | |
| 		"off", "on", "unknown"
 | |
| 	};
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	for (i = 0; i < data->num_pd; i++) {
 | |
| 		pd = &data->pd[i];
 | |
| 		if (pd->psc != psc)
 | |
| 			continue;
 | |
| 		state = ti_pd_state(pd);
 | |
| 		if (state > ARRAY_SIZE(pd_states))
 | |
| 			state = ARRAY_SIZE(pd_states) - 1;
 | |
| 		printf("  PD%d: state=%s, usecount=%d:\n",
 | |
| 		       pd->id, pd_states[state], pd->usecount);
 | |
| 		dump_lpsc(data, pd);
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| static void dump_psc(struct ti_k3_pd_platdata *data)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	int i;
 | |
| 	struct ti_psc *psc;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	for (i = 0; i < data->num_psc; i++) {
 | |
| 		psc = &data->psc[i];
 | |
| 		printf("PSC%d [%p]:\n", psc->id, psc->base);
 | |
| 		dump_pd(data, psc);
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| static int do_pd_dump(struct cmd_tbl *cmdtp, int flag, int argc,
 | |
| 		      char *const argv[])
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	struct ti_k3_pd_platdata *data;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	data = ti_pd_find_data();
 | |
| 	if (!data)
 | |
| 		return CMD_RET_FAILURE;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	dump_psc(data);
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	return 0;
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| static int do_pd_endis(int argc, char *const argv[], u8 state)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	u32 psc_id;
 | |
| 	u32 lpsc_id;
 | |
| 	int i;
 | |
| 	struct ti_k3_pd_platdata *data;
 | |
| 	struct ti_lpsc *lpsc;
 | |
| 	int ret;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(argc < 3)
 | |
| 		return CMD_RET_FAILURE;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	data = ti_pd_find_data();
 | |
| 	if (!data)
 | |
| 		return CMD_RET_FAILURE;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	psc_id = dectoul(argv[1], NULL);
 | |
| 	lpsc_id = dectoul(argv[2], NULL);
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	for (i = 0; i < data->num_lpsc; i++) {
 | |
| 		lpsc = &data->lpsc[i];
 | |
| 		if (lpsc->pd->psc->id != psc_id)
 | |
| 			continue;
 | |
| 		if (lpsc->id != lpsc_id)
 | |
| 			continue;
 | |
| 		printf("%s pd [PSC:%d,LPSC:%d]...\n",
 | |
| 		       state == MDSTAT_STATE_ENABLE ? "Enabling" : "Disabling",
 | |
| 		       psc_id, lpsc_id);
 | |
| 		ret = ti_lpsc_transition(lpsc, state);
 | |
| 		if (ret)
 | |
| 			return CMD_RET_FAILURE;
 | |
| 		else
 | |
| 			return 0;
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	printf("No matching psc/lpsc found.\n");
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	return CMD_RET_FAILURE;
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| static int do_pd_enable(struct cmd_tbl *cmdtp, int flag, int argc,
 | |
| 			char *const argv[])
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	return do_pd_endis(argc, argv, MDSTAT_STATE_ENABLE);
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| static int do_pd_disable(struct cmd_tbl *cmdtp, int flag, int argc,
 | |
| 			 char *const argv[])
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	return do_pd_endis(argc, argv, MDSTAT_STATE_SWRSTDISABLE);
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| static struct cmd_tbl cmd_pd[] = {
 | |
| 	U_BOOT_CMD_MKENT(dump, 1, 0, do_pd_dump, "", ""),
 | |
| 	U_BOOT_CMD_MKENT(enable, 3, 0, do_pd_enable, "", ""),
 | |
| 	U_BOOT_CMD_MKENT(disable, 3, 0, do_pd_disable, "", ""),
 | |
| };
 | |
| 
 | |
| static int ti_do_pd(struct cmd_tbl *cmdtp, int flag, int argc, char * const argv[])
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	struct cmd_tbl *c;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	argc--;
 | |
| 	argv++;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	c = find_cmd_tbl(argv[0], cmd_pd, ARRAY_SIZE(cmd_pd));
 | |
| 	if (c)
 | |
| 		return c->cmd(cmdtp, flag, argc, argv);
 | |
| 	else
 | |
| 		return CMD_RET_USAGE;
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| U_BOOT_LONGHELP(pd,
 | |
| 	   "dump                 - show power domain status\n"
 | |
| 	   "enable [psc] [lpsc]  - enable power domain\n"
 | |
| 	   "disable [psc] [lpsc] - disable power domain\n");
 | |
| 
 | |
| U_BOOT_CMD(pd, 4, 1, ti_do_pd,
 | |
| 	   "TI power domain control", pd_help_text
 | |
| );
